Sea Flower
Calming the waters,
Stilling the tide,
Under the waves
Your roots do hide.
A rare sighting whenever seen,
Sea flower go floating away
From a garden green.
Your petals be the sail
Catching the wind
To venture along the seven seas,
Then you fail to hold it all in,
Losing your petals
When the oceans freeze.
Blossoming in the waters
Warmed by the tropical sun,
And when it sets
You sail on.
I've seen you sea flower,
On the highest waves you ride
Surrendering on the shore at my feet,
Then taken back out by the tide.
Only the sea flower knows
The ocean's truths,
I was wrong to try....
And tame it's wild roots.
